"Letter To A Child Never Born" Written by Oriana Fallaci (World Renowned Author Of A Man)
Review: This book touches on the real meaning of being a woman, the power of giving life or not. When the book begins, the protagonist is upset after learning she is pregnant. She knows nothing about the child, except that this creature depends totally and uniquely on her own Choices.
The Creation of another person directly within one's own body is a very shocking thing. This responsibility is huge. If the child could choose, would he prefer to be born, to grow up, and to suffer, or would he return to the joyful limbo from which he came?
A woman's freedom and individuality are also challenged by a newborn, should she renounce her freedom, her job, and her choice? What should she do at this point?
